structure with function pointers
Hi,
compiled the following code with visual studio 2102 and got an error in the red line.
Code:
#include "stdafx.h"
#include <iostream>
struct MyStruct {
int (*foo)();
};
static int func1()
{
printf("I am called\n");
return 0;
}
static struct MyStruct a = {
.foo = func1 //getting error here as shown below
};
int main()
{
a.foo();
return 0;
}
Error 1 error C2143: syntax error : missing '}' before '.'
Error 2 error C2143: syntax error : missing ';' before '.'
Error 3 error C2059: syntax error : '.'
Error 4 error C2143: syntax error : missing ';' before '}'
Error 5 error C2059: syntax error : '}'
6 IntelliSense: expected an expression

Compiles OK as C++20 with VS2019.
